Read these sentences from the speech there is no negro problem. There is no southern problem. There is no northern problem. Ther

e is only an American problem. How do these sentences convey Johnson’s viewpoint ?
English
1 answer:
djyliett [7]3 years ago
7 0

Answer:

In my opinion, the correct  answer is clarity. By using the repetition, the author tries to clarify what this problem isn't - by its nature it isn't Negro, Southern, or Northern. And then, he affirms what it is - it is American. Therefore, he says that compartmentalizing this problem is not going to help. People have to understand it for what it really is - everyone's problem, the problem of the nation itself.
